A group project of testing different algorithms of maze solving
-
Updated
Dec 11, 2020 - Java
A maze is a type of puzzle involving a collection of paths, usually where a player has to find a route from start to finish.
A huge variety of algorithms exist for generating and solving mazes. These are not only fun to implement, but also are a good way to familiarise yourself with programming techniques, algorithms, and languages.
A group project of testing different algorithms of maze solving
Path finding and maze generating visualisation
The game of maze using MatterJS and Recursion
Maze generator and solver in sed.
The Maze Project: Main docs
Visualizer for maze generation and pathfinding algorithms .
An app to demonstrate pathing (or pathfinding) algorithms and maze generation algorithms.
Казуальная игра с процедурной генерацией лабиринта (С#, Unity3D)
Unity3D Maze game
PHP implementation of The Maze Project
A Prim's maze generation algorithm and recursive backtracker implementation in C#.
Welcome to my Unity platformer game, where players must escape a dynamically generated platform before time runs out! In this exciting project, the platform layout is randomized for each playthrough, offering endless challenges and surprises to keep players engaged and entertained.
The following project looks at mapping out a base maze. Implements a recursive algorithm(DPF) to mow the maze. In addition, Breadth First Search is implemented in order to drop "candy" along the path, which the user can pick up while solving the maze.
Pathfinding Visualizer with JavaFx
An app to visualize path finding
Maze generation tool for visualizing different generation algorithms.
Generate and solve a maze
A maze visualization with advanced algorithms to generate a maze and path find between two points.